Lord of the Rings, Return of the King (DVD)

Tomorrow the final installation of the Lord of the Rings (LOTR) trilogy comes out on DVD. Since I get a chance to preview the DVD before it hits the streets I thought I should let everyone in on what to expect Tuesday. The final DVD for LOTR comes with two discs. The first disc contains the movie and the second is used for extras. I'm going to skip over talking about the first disc because it's so/so. The second disc with the extras is extremely disappointing. They basically kept repeating the same five minutes of footage over and over again. It's amazing how long you can make five minutes of film last if you narrate it. If you don't already own one of the LOTR movies, keep away from this one. Its okay to rent as long as you keep away from disc two. If you want to buy it I suggest getting all three movies in a collectors pack, which is bound to be out in the next year.

G-Mail

Google has been beta testing its email service known as G-Mail for a month now, and even though it has yet to be publicly released it is already raising eyebrows. The email service is offering a full gigabyte of storage for it's clients for FREE! Yahoo!'s free email service currently only offers 20 megabytes of storage. That is fifty times more storage, for those who don't know how to push nerd numbers. Google's email will also incorporate their ingenious search engine technology into the email, making it easy to search through that gigabyte of mail. There is one downside to it involving privacy issues in the advertisements google ads to some of your mail. To learn more about G-Mail, check out Oreillynet.com's Helpful Article.

Handhelds from E3!

Just had to show off the new PSP (Playstation Portable, pictured below)...

and Nintendo DS (Dual Screen, below). Take note that the lower screen on the DS is a touch screen. Oh, and both handhelds utilize 802.11b technology (Hello Wi-Fi Gaming!). Both handhelds are scheduled to come out within the next year. Nintendo claims its release in the Fall for Japan, Europe, and North America. Playstation will release in Japan this Fall, soon to be followed by a release in Europe and North America Q1 of 2005. Hopefully Halo 2 will keep me distracted during those lonely Q4 months.
